你查询的IP:[121.4.92.56]  地理位置:中国–上海–上海

最新查询122.4.95.67 210.78.253.98 220.154.41.7 121.201.127.180 118.192.211.118 202.112.218.76 211.80.24.92 60.247.182.41 116.8.86.67 121.4.92.56 119.18.192.42 125.210.159.178 124.28.192.215 202.122.128.81 202.38.156.183 218.64.250.59 118.67.112.138 119.58.208.156 202.143.16.60 120.90.227.241 117.106.106.97 124.126.90.54 116.198.31.232 116.58.128.243 221.198.82.191 202.127.192.192 122.49.215.70 123.103.192.229 220.160.229.100 123.64.9.252 121.100.128.106